I am a huge fan of shrimp cocktail. Whether it is in traditional form, or served Mexican style, it is one of those foods I crave. I learned how to poach shrimp at a young age, but I wasn't exposed to the Mexican style "coctel" until I was 24 years old. I was living in Alaska and my friend, Bertha, showed me the ropes.
